Kawaguchi City has a high density of condominiums and apartment buildings, leading many residents to utilize balconies for laundry and storage to compensate for limited indoor space. However, many residents struggle with items such as weather-degraded storage boxes and laundry drying equipment that are left occupying space. In response, Marutto Honpo (operated by SYSTR Inc.), a professional waste collection service, is launching the "Balcony Storage Waste Bulk Collection Campaign," exclusive to Kawaguchi City, running from June 1st to June 30th.

Customers who utilize the flat-rate collection plans are eligible for a discount of up to 1,000 yen when including degraded balcony items in the pick-up. Eligible items include storage boxes, drying poles, racks, and hangers. The company offers quote consultations via LINE by uploading photos, making it easy to dispose of long or bulky items.
